System.Net.WebSockets.WebSocketHandle.CreateSecKeyAndSecWebSocketAccept C# (CSharp) Méthode

CreateSecKeyAndSecWebSocketAccept() private méthode

private CreateSecKeyAndSecWebSocketAccept ( ) : string>.KeyValuePair
Résultat string>.KeyValuePair
        private static KeyValuePair<string, string> CreateSecKeyAndSecWebSocketAccept()
        {
            string secKey = Convert.ToBase64String(Guid.NewGuid().ToByteArray());
            using (SHA1 sha = SHA1.Create())
            {
                return new KeyValuePair<string, string>(
                    secKey,
                    Convert.ToBase64String(sha.ComputeHash(Encoding.ASCII.GetBytes(secKey + WSServerGuid))));
            }
        }